      The dancer. The mother. The cop. The artist. The wife.

      These women live by countless unspoken rules. How to dress; who to trust; which streets are safe and which are not. The rules grow out of a kaleidoscope of fear, anguish, power, loss and hope. Maybe it is only these rules which keep them alive.

      When their neighbourhood is rocked by two murders, the careful existence these women have built for themselves begins to crumble…

      ‘Pochoda turns grief, suffering and loss into art, crafting a literary thriller that is no less compelling for its deep emotional resonance.’ Vogue
